SSC CGL Trigonometry Practice Test 1
15 SSC CGL trigonometry questions on standard values, identities, and complementary angle relations.
Preview all 15 questions in SSC CGL Trigonometry Practice Test 1 (no login required)
- Standard Angle
1. The value of cos 60° is:
- A. 0
- B. 1/2 (Correct)
- C. √3/2
- D. 1
Explanation: cos 60° is 1/2.
- Standard Angle
2. The value of tan 30° is:
- A. 1/√3 (Correct)
- B. 1
- C. √3
- D. 1/2
Explanation: tan 30° = 1/√3.
- Identity
3. sin² A + cos² A is equal to:
- A. 0
- B. 1 (Correct)
- C. tan A
- D. sec A
Explanation: This is the basic trigonometric identity.
- Complementary Angle
4. sin 35° is equal to:
- A. cos 35°
- B. cos 55° (Correct)
- C. tan 55°
- D. sec 35°
Explanation: sin θ = cos (90° - θ).
- Standard Angle
5. The value of sec 60° is:
- A. 1/2
- B. 1
- C. 2 (Correct)
- D. √3
Explanation: sec 60° = 1 / cos 60° = 2.
- Identity
6. If tan A = 1, then A may be:
- A. 30°
- B. 45° (Correct)
- C. 60°
- D. 90°
Explanation: tan 45° = 1.
- Standard Angle
7. The value of cosec 30° is:
- A. 1
- B. 2 (Correct)
- C. √3
- D. 1/2
Explanation: cosec 30° = 1 / sin 30° = 2.
- Complementary Angle
8. cos 20° is equal to:
- A. sin 20°
- B. sin 70° (Correct)
- C. tan 70°
- D. sec 20°
Explanation: cos θ = sin (90° - θ).
- Identity
9. 1 + tan² A is equal to:
- A. sec² A (Correct)
- B. cosec² A
- C. cot² A
- D. sin² A
Explanation: 1 + tan² A = sec² A.
- Standard Angle
10. The value of cos 0° is:
- A. 0
- B. 1/2
- C. 1 (Correct)
- D. Undefined
Explanation: cos 0° = 1.
- Standard Angle
11. The value of tan 45° + sin 30° is:
- A. 1
- B. 3/2 (Correct)
- C. √3/2
- D. 2
Explanation: tan 45° = 1 and sin 30° = 1/2, so sum = 3/2.
- Ratio
12. If sin A = 3/5, then cos A is:
- A. 3/5
- B. 4/5 (Correct)
- C. 5/4
- D. 5/3
Explanation: Using a 3-4-5 triangle, cos A = adjacent/hypotenuse = 4/5.
- Ratio
13. If cos A = 12/13, then tan A is:
- A. 5/12 (Correct)
- B. 12/5
- C. 13/5
- D. 5/13
Explanation: Using a 5-12-13 triangle, tan A = perpendicular/base = 5/12.
- Standard Angle
14. The value of sin 90° is:
- A. 0
- B. 1/2
- C. 1 (Correct)
- D. √3/2
Explanation: sin 90° = 1.
- Identity
15. If sec A = 5/4, then cos A is:
- A. 4/5 (Correct)
- B. 5/4
- C. 3/5
- D. 1/5
Explanation: cos A is the reciprocal of sec A.
